Simplifying Schmidt number witnesses via higher-dimensional embeddings
(pp207-221)
F. Hulpke, D. Bruss, M.
Levenstein, and A. Sanpera
doi:
https://doi.org/10.26421/QIC4.3-6
Abstracts:
We apply the generalised concept of witness operators to
arbitrary convex sets, and review the criteria for the optimisation of
these general witnesses. We then define an embedding of state vectors
and operators into a higher-dimensional Hilbert space. This embedding
leads to a connection between any Schmidt number witness in the original
Hilbert space and a witness for Schmidt number two (i.e. the most
general entanglement witness) in the appropriate enlarged Hilbert space.
Using this relation we arrive at a conceptually simple method for the
construction of Schmidt number witnesses in bipartite systems.
